Slazenger went to goals astray in the opening ten minutes and never recovered from this disastrous start.
The visitors eventually found their feet, but failed to find their usual fluid style.
In fact, Slazenger conceded a third goal before Marcus Taylor’s battling midfield display rekindled Slazenger’s spirits.
Nick Webb and Simon Chamberlain combined to produced the first Slazenger score through Andy Foreman.
Unfortunately, once again sloppy defending let Bradford in for their fourth and despite a late consolation goal for Slazenger from Webb, they were left annoyed and frustrated by their performance.
